Brooklyn Beckham, the oldest David and Victoria Beckham, has finally spoken out amid speculation of major family turmoil. In a series of scathing Instagram posts, the young Beckham accused his parents of attempting to "ruin" his marriage to Nicola Peltz.

In the years since the 26-year-old married the actress, 31, Beckham's relationship with his parents has publicly floundered. Seemingly confirming that the Beckhams were at odds with their eldest child, in a New Year's Eve post, David Beckham acknowledged his other three children, Romeo, 23, Cruz, 20, and Harper, 14, while a mention or picture of Brooklyn was absent.

In the posts, Brooklyn wrote that he does not want to "reconcile" with his parents.. "I'm not being controlled. I'm standing up for myself for the first time in my life," he explained.

"For my entire life, my parents have controlled narratives in the press about our family. The performative social media posts, family events and inauthentic relationships have been a fixture of the life I was born into," Brooklyn continued.

Elsewhere, Brooklyn claimed that David and Victoria Beckham have "endlessly tried to ruin my relationship" well before he and Peltz tied the knot. Among other accusations was Victoria halting her planned design of her daughter-in-law's wedding dress at the last minute, along with alleged attempts of pressuring Brooklyn to sign away the rights to his name.

"They were adamant on me signing before my wedding date because then the terms of the deal would be initiated," Brooklyn claimed. "My holdout affected the payday and they have never treated me the same since."

Brooklyn also alleged that his relationship with his parents further strained in the years since he and Peltz married, adding that that he's received "relentless attacks" both personally and in the press.

"My mum hijacked my first dance with my wife, which had been planned weeks in advance to a romantic love song," Brooklyn wrote. He also recalled that Latin vocalist Marc Anthony called him and Peltz to the stage for their first dance and claimed that his mother danced "very inappropriately" with him. "I've never felt more uncomfortable or humiliated in my entire life," he continued.

After claiming that Peltz has been "constantly disrespected" by his parents, Brooklyn ended by writing that the "narrative" that his wife "controls" him is "completely backwards."

"I grew up with overwhelming anxiety," Brooklyn wrote. "For the first time in my life, since stepping away from my family, that anxiety has disappeared."
